Funds are all fine, the response we got from everybody was incredible so we've got more than enough in there to keep producing for a long time.  We spoke with our local council PPE guy last week and he said that they're starting to see large-scale manufacturers get up to speed now so there should be a lot more equipment coming into the supply chains over the coming weeks.  There's one near us here (Labman) who are producing 1000's per day so once they've supplied all of the hospitals they can start distributing to the care homes, surgeries, pharmacies that we're currently getting requests from.

PPE Update (Mon): We're getting on top of the production so for the first time in 3 weeks we've got face shields prepped and ready to go straight out! The requests are slowing down as the regular PPE channels get up to speed, but we'll keep going for now until the material runs out (at 6000 produced) and see whether we're still needed.

Today's batches went out to:
North East Nursing & Care Services. (300)
Stanley Park care home (100)
Middlesbrough Grange Residential Care Home (30)

Shame you are not closer to Bristol Leon - the need amongst the local smaller in-home elderly and dementia support care businesses is still urgent.

We know of one local Bristol business - Home Instead - that enables the elderly to remain in their own homes with daily support - where the staff are having to use home-made masks, as they just cannot get anything else. Often their customers are very frail and medically very vulnerable but are strong-willed and self determined enough to want to remain in their homes and the community, and they rely on these staff as a daily life-line and much needed company against total isolation. 

I am sure there must be similar situations up near you as well but I expect these small businesses - with hugely dedicated staff - probably are unaware that the fantastic service you provide is available to them.

PPE Update (Sunday): We'd like to thank everyone again for all of your donations, the response we've received has been incredible and we really appreciate your generosity during these difficult times.

We've seen the requests for the PPE really slow down over the last 7 days and we've only got 10 face shields booked in for this coming week. We've also got close to 300 face shields prepped and ready to go out as soon as folks need them. From talking to our local council it would seem that the proper PPE supply routes are getting back up to speed now, which is fantastic.

At this point we've decided to turn off the donations for the funding, as we've got more than enough here to pay for all of the material costs we've incurred so far. If something changes and we need to resume face shield production, we've got enough to pay for further material if necessary. We could also look at using some of the funds to purchase professional face shields and distribute those instead.

There will be a chunk of money left over which will be donated to charity. Once we've got the rest of the face shields sent out and things have calmed down a little, we'll be sending out a full costing breakdown so that you can see exactly where your donations have been spent and which charities we have donated to.

Thanks again for your support, it means so much to so many people currently on the frontline. We're all living in a strange world right now and to see everyone working together towards something positive has been fantastic to be a part of.
